Bitter Creek to Walcott WY, June 1
"...At Fort Steele there is nothing left but the ruins of abandoned houses. I now follow the old immigrant trail that winds across the River Platte..."
Waypoint Today: Wyman attempted to cross the North Platte River over the UPRR trestle. But, the Bridge foreman refused his passage. Wyman was forced to follow the Old Immigrant trail to cross the river on the north side of the railroad tracks.
